In terms of quality, both brushes have a high level of quality, with no loose parts. The hairs (which are synthetic) are similarly high quality: no fraying or fall-out, and they aren’t very shiny either. Awesome!

 

 
The first brush I will be taking a look at is the larger of the two: a highlighter brush!

The hairs on this brush are sooo soft! Omg, it’s like the softest plushie! It’s soft when you swirl, swipe or tap with the brush! In fact, it may be the softest when you tap! It’s so luxuriously soft, and feels extremely nice on skin! The shape of this brush is ideal for highlighters; it is a classic tapered highlighter brush that makes it easy to precisely highlight the high points of the face. 
 

This brush picks up a ton of pigment! Like, actually too much! So I have to be careful how I highlight with it if I don’t want to be glowing. It applies pigment very richly, so be careful how much pressure you apply if you want to have subtle highlighting. It’s also super precise thanks to the tapered shape, so it’s easy to highlight smaller areas such as the cupid’s bow or the tip of the nose. And it also blends pigments excellently! 
 
 
This brush is incredibly easy to use, and I love to use it! I often reach for it when I need a highlighter brush because I know it’s going to give me fantastic results!

 
 
Washing: oh it’s magnificently easy to wash! It doesn’t absorb shampoo, so rinsing it out only takes like 30 seconds. The pure white hairs stay in perfect condition after a wash, the same shape, no fall-out and, it seems, no yellow discolouration at the base.

Now, the second – and much smaller – brush! This is a classic eyeshadow shader brush.

The hairs aren’t very shiny, and they look pretty high quality. But there is one hair that is way longer than the others (ngl, it’s annoying me). The hairs are super soft, but they also feel firm (the hairs are quite short after all). It doesn’t feel hard though, so it’s still very pleasant to use. The shape is very good for applying eyeshadows onto the eyelid as it’s dense and small. 
 
Indeed, this brush is excellent! At least for applying eyeshadows, because it’s far too dense to be able to blend at all. It could be used to smudge, but it’s really best for simply applying pigments. And that’s not a bad thing – I’d rather it be excellent at just one job than be mediocre at multiple ones! It picks up a huge amount of pigment, so much that it often causes eyeshadows to have fall-out from how much it picks up! This is awesome! 
 
 
It ensures that you get maximum pigmentation from the eyeshadow you’re using. It applies it incredibly evenly and quite precisely, which makes it suitable to be used for smokey eye looks. It’s precise enough to add definition in the outer V or the crease easily, without it looking too smudgy. It’s so fun to use! And it makes creating even more complex looks a breeze! Just be sure to have a spare blending brush at hand!
 
Washing: as easy as can be! Since it doesn’t absorb shampoo it is super easy to rinse it all out and have a perfectly clean brush! There’s no fall-out or fraying after a wash and it keeps its shape. However, like with many Essence brushes that have pure white hairs, there may be some slight discolouration at the base post-wash; this is likely the glue seeping down, but don’t worry, it doesn’t seem to cause any problems. 
 
 
I’ve already washed this brush multiple times and this discolouration didn’t seem to do a thing.
